Nephus voeltzkowi

Nephus (Nephus) voeltzkowi is a species of ladybug belonging to the family Coccinellidae naturally occurring in Sub-Saharan Africa, Mascarene archipelagos, and the Azores islands, but also found in the United States (Florida).

[1] This species exhibits the first case of parthenogenesis in ladybugs.

[2] Nephus voeltzkowi can reach a length of 1.65 millimetres (0.065 in) and feeds on mealybugs.

Elytra are black, each with one yellowish big oval spot.

The body is oval-shaped with short fine whitish pubescence.
